What Are Energy-Efficient Windows?

Energy-efficient windows are created to reduce heat transfer between the interior of a home and its outside environment. By utilizing advanced innovations and materials, these windows assist preserve comfortable indoor temperatures regardless of the season, ultimately leading to lowered energy intake and lower utility bills.

The Science Behind Energy Efficiency

Energy-efficient windows use different technologies to enhance their performance. The following table lays out essential parts and their functions:

ComponentDescription
Low-E GlassCoated with a thin layer that reflects heat while allowing light in, keeping indoor temperature.
Double Glazed Windows or Triple GlazingSeveral panes of glass develop insulating air areas, minimizing heat transfer.
Gas FillsArgon or krypton gas fills the areas between glass panes, improving insulation.
Warm Edge SpacersUtilized between panes to reduce heat loss and improve toughness.
Frame MaterialsVinyl, fiberglass, and wood frames offer varying energy efficiency and aesthetics.

Elements Influencing Energy Efficiency

A number of important factors contribute to the general energy efficiency of windows, as summed up in the following table:

FactorDescription
U-FactorSteps the rate of heat transfer; lower values indicate better insulation.
Solar Heat Gain Coefficient (SHGC)Quantifies how much solar radiation is admitted; lower values reduce heat from the sun.
Visible Transmittance (VT)Reflects how much natural light is sent; a balance in between natural light and heat gain is important.
Air LeakageThe amount of air that leaks through the window frame; very little leak is crucial for energy efficiency.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. How can I inform if my windows are energy-efficient?Search for labels from the National Fenestration Rating Council (NFRC) that supply details on performance scores.

2. Are energy-efficient windows worth the financial investment?Yes, they use long-lasting cost savings on energy expenses, increased comfort, and improve home worth.

3. For how long do energy-efficient windows last?Usually, they have a lifespan of 20-25 years, but this can vary based upon products and maintenance.

4. Can I retrofit my existing windows for energy effectiveness?Yes, options like Storm Windows Installation windows or window films can enhance the efficiency of existing windows without total replacement.

5. Exists a distinction between energy-efficient windows and low-E windows?Low-E windows are a type of energy-efficient window that specifically has a low-emissivity finish to minimize heat transfer.
